Like most fire departments in Lancaster County, Ephrata Pioneer Fire Company is staffed entirely by volunteers. We are always looking for volunteers to help us in a variety of ways. Read the descriptions below for more information on how you can get involved.
Firefighter
A firefighter is an individual trained to perform the function of fire prevention and suppression. Firefighters must possess both the knowledge and skills to be able to perform safely and effectively at an emergency scene. Duties include but are not limited to interior/exterior fire suppression, vehicle rescue, water rescue, confined space rescue, drivers/operators, equipment maintenance, first aid response, training, fund raising, participation in community activities and continued skill enhancement.

Fire Police
A Pioneer Fire Company fire police officer, once trained, will become a recognized law enforcement officer under the direction of the volunteer fire department. Duties may include but are not limited to controlling traffic and crowds at both emergency and non-emergency scene, fund raising and participation in community activities. Members may be called upon at all hours of the day to assist with scene control. Members will work along with local public agencies.

Pioneer Auxiliary
The Ephrata Pioneer Fire Company Auxiliary is a recognized group of individuals within the fire company whose activities involve fundraising such as making and selling Easter Candy, having a Food Stand Parade Night at the fire station and operating the Auxiliary trailer uptown at the Ephrata Fair which has a cake, candy/soda spin. The Auxiliary is also involved with community activities such as an Open House at the fire station to support the fire company and the Auxiliary. The Auxiliary provides support to the firemen and fire police by bringing food and beverages to them when they have been on a fire call or emergency scene for an extended period of time. They also give support to the fireman and fire police by providing them with food and beverages during severe weather standbys in the fire station or when the fire station is utilized as an emergency shelter. These members are an important part of a volunteer fire service.
The Auxiliary meets the first Tuesday of the month at 7:30 PM in the downstairs Banquet Hall at the fire station.

Social Member
A social member of the Pioneer Fire Company will be recognized as a member of the volunteer fire department, though they will not be required to respond as an emergency service provider. Duties may include but are not limited to station maintenance, firefighter support services, fundraising, fire prevention and numerous other departmental and community activities.
